Don’t Have an Alcoholic Beverage … Gamble!

February 7th, 2024 Leave a comment Go to comments

If you enjoy a beer occasionally, leave your cash out of the casino if you are going to do your drinking in a casino. I’m serious. Leave your purse, your billfold, and keep all cash, plastic credit and checkbooks out of the casino. Grab whatever money you expect to use on drinks, tips and only the pocket change you intend to burn and leave the rest behind.

Cynical? Not by any means. Just realistic. You could have a win after a intoxicated night out with your compatriots and be blessed enough to hook a 25 minute roll at a hot craps game. Keep that story considering that it’s as brief as it gets if you continually drink alcohol and gamble. The pair simply don’t go well together.

Leaving your moola at home might be a little bit excessive, but precautionary measures for dramatic behavior is a requirement. If you wager to win, then do not drink alcohol and bet. If you like to blow your cash without a worry, then drink all the no charge booze your stomach are able to handle, but don’t take charge cards and cheques to toss into the mix of going after squanderings after your drunk as a skunk head loses all the cash!

Let me to carry this one step more. do not consume alcohol and then hop on the web to bet in your favorite online casino either. I love to drink from the coziness of my domicile, however due to the fact that I’m connected through Neteller, Firepay and have credit cards near by, I can not drink and gamble.

Why? Even though I don’t consume alcohol to excess, when I consume alcohol, it is definitely enough to befuddle my better judgment. I gamble, so I do not drink alcohol when betting. If you are more of a drinker, do not wager when you do. Both make for an awful, and costly, cocktail.
